Node-Red Function Node Multiple Outputs (Fonksiyon Düğümü Nasıl Kullanılır?)
Bu eğitimde node-red de fonksiyon düğümün çoklu mesaj yayınlama (Outputs) durumunu inceleyeceğiz. Bu örnekte 3 çıkışlı fonksiyon oluşturacağız. Siz ihtiyacınız kadar oluşturabilirsiniz.
1)Node-Red Function Outputs ekleyelim
Fonksiyonumuzun “Properties” ayarlarından “Setup” kısmına ulaşalım. “Outputs” kısmındaki inputu 3 olarak ayarlayalım.
2) Outputs lara gidecek verileri oluşturuyoruz.
Ardışık olarak birden çok mesaj göndermek için bir dizi oluşturabilirsiniz.
1.Çıkış = msg1,msg2 2.Çıkış = msg3 3.Çıkış = msg4
Farklı bir senaryo oluşturalım
Bir json datası geldini varsayalım.
(Satır 3) String verilerini nesneye dönüştürüyoruz.
(Satır 9) Sensörden yanlış veri olup olmadığını kontrol ediyoruz.
Gelen veriler yanlışsa “Hata = doğru”, aksi takdirde “Hata = yanlış”.
“Error = false” ise veri 3 çıkışa iletilir.
“Error = doğru” ise, yalnızca çıkış 3 bir hata mesajı alır. Çıkış 1 ve 2’ye boş bir değer iletilir.